Output 300db069df34212d1a69270809ee6b65a0da9e69782a0a3fabd13b502d86bf61:3

value
95028217
script pubkey
OP_0 OP_PUSHBYTES_20 ebeed2f5cbb848032f03da82e955aed637e5f13f
address
bc1qa0hd9awthpyqxtcrm2pwj4dw6cm7tuflxws7qh
transaction
300db069df34212d1a69270809ee6b65a0da9e69782a0a3fabd13b502d86bf61
spent
true